| Eusébio Cup 2008 - 01 August 2008 |
The newly created Eusébio Cup was officially presented yesterday by Benfica's chairman Luis Filipe Vieira, sporting director Rui Costa, manager Quique Flores, and the «King» himself Eusébio da Silva Ferreira.
This annual tournament will be played at the Estádio da Luz, and this year, only Inter Milan will join the hosts, and preparations are already under way to increase the amount of teams to 4 from next year.
Eusébio didn't hide his emotions for being honoured once more by Benfica:
"It is already an honour having your statue outside the Luz, and now there is a competition with my name. I want to live a long life, but I know this tribute will live forever."
"I think Internazionale was a good choice. I have played against them and knew of their interest in signing me back in the day. Today, it is a club coached by a Portuguese (José Mourinho) and they also have Figo and Pelé. I hope it will be a great game and that the cup will stay at home, because this is the first edition and has a lot of value."
LF Vieira and Rui Costa paid tribute to the legendary player for staying and representing Benfica all these years. The ex-Benfica «number 10» showed his gratitude to the man who influenced him to stay at Benfica.
"I would like to thank him for representing Benfica like no man could in Portugal. It was him who made me stay in Benfica as a kid and it is with joy to be here during the first edition of this Cup. I hope it will be a wonderful day."
Rui Costa and Quique Flores admitted that the Benfica team will be near their best come 15th August. The manager is hoping for a good atmosphere during this event.
"The fans are aware that Benfica are undergoing a new cycle. We will field the best available team and one that can represent Benfica what it stands for."
"I wish for a good atmosphere and something that will reflect throughout the season."

Estádio da Luz construction |
Inaugurated in 2003, Estádio do Sport Lisboa e Benfica was built mainly during 2002/03 to replace the famous Estádio da Luz for the 2004 European Championships. With the finals in mind, the 5-star rated venue was designed for the greatest games and events, continuing the tradition of the biggest stadium in Portugal.
